A pest management professional with expert, up-to-date understanding of the Weston location and its particular property building and construction types is vital for precise risk evaluation. These experts do not depend on uncertainty; they use sophisticated, non-invasive detection devices, consisting of thermal imaging cameras and high-precision wetness metres. These tools allow the professional to properly determine the subtle heat signatures and moisture anomalies that betray the covert paths and active presence of termite nests deep within a structure's structures or wall cavities. Homeowners in Weston must strictly stick to one crucial rule: need to live termites be discovered, they must never ever, under any situations, be disrupted, sprayed, or treated with domestic insecticides. Such agitation will just trigger the foraging insects to seal off the affected zone, retreat, and instantly move their feeding activity to a completely various, and often far less accessible, area of the building. This instant disruption inevitably makes complex and considerably increases the intricacy and cost of carrying out the needed professional Weston Termite Treatment needed for long-term colony eradication.
After carrying out a comprehensive expert evaluation of the threats included and validating the requirement for intervention, the technician will suggest the best method for resolving termite infestation in Weston. Typically, this decision includes choosing in between two well-supported approaches that concentrate on successfully eradicating termite nests: applying liquid chemical barriers in the soil or executing advanced termite baiting and tracking systems.
A tested and commonly embraced technique of termite control, the liquid chemical barrier is a conventional yet extremely reliable element of termite treatment. It involves producing an extensive, undisturbed treated zone in the soil that entirely surrounds and extends below the foundation of the residential or commercial property. This labor-intensive process generally needs precise trenching around the property's border and drilling through hard surfaces like concrete to administer a non-repellent termiticide. The undetectable nature of this termiticide permits termites to unwittingly enter contact with the lethal chemical, which then abides by their bodies and is moved to the remainder of the nest through social behaviors such as grooming and food sharing. As a result, the slow-acting chemical ultimately reaches the queen and king, leading to the colony's downfall. When installed correctly, a chemical barrier uses instant and comprehensive defense, frequently supported by a multi-year guarantee. However, its long-term success depends on keeping the barrier's stability, making regular yearly examinations vital to determine and address any breaches brought on by external aspects.

This approach involves placing inconspicuous bait stations around the home's border, filled with a cellulose-based substance containing a slow-acting insect development regulator. Termites are attracted to the bait, consuming it and sharing it with their nest, which eventually interrupts their molting cycle and causes the colony's death. In addition, all brand-new structure jobs in the Weston area should comply with local building policies by incorporating an approved pre-construction Termite Management System. This proactive step serves as the strongest defense for a brand-new house. Choices for implementation consist of the installation of difficult physical barriers, like stainless-steel mesh or specifically dealt with composite sheeting, listed below the foundation and around energy entry points, or making use of reticulated pipeline systems for practical and safe replenishment of a sub-slab chemical treatment.
